Voluntary Carbon Credit Market Opportunity, Growth Drivers, Industry Trend Analysis, and Forecast 2025 - 2034

The Global Voluntary Carbon Credit Market, valued at USD 1.7 billion in 2024, is poised for exceptional growth, with a projected CAGR of 25% from 2025 to 2034. This expansion is driven by the increasing adoption of carbon reduction projects, including renewable energy initiatives, reforestation, and emerging technologies such as carbon capture and storage (CCS).

As industries and governments intensify their efforts to meet environmental goals, the demand for carbon credits has surged. The market is not only expanding in scale but also in diversity as companies increasingly embrace nature-based solutions like afforestation and reforestation that offer measurable environmental, social, and economic benefits. These solutions are helping create a more sustainable future, which is prompting businesses to pursue carbon credits to fulfill their commitments to reduce their carbon footprint.

By 2034, the voluntary carbon credit market is expected to generate USD 15 billion, driven by evolving corporate practices, heightened environmental awareness, and a global push for sustainability. A key factor contributing to the market's rapid expansion is the rising demand for nature-based solutions, which simultaneously mitigate climate change and support ecological restoration. Afforestation and reforestation initiatives, in particular, have become increasingly favored due to their dual impact on carbon sequestration and biodiversity preservation. With corporate sustainability pledges becoming more mainstream, businesses are actively seeking effective and credible ways to offset their emissions, with carbon credits offering a viable solution. Standards like the Verified Carbon Standard (VCS) are gaining traction as companies prioritize transparency, accuracy, and credibility in the certification and measurement of carbon credits.

The forestry and land use sector, in particular, is anticipated to grow at a CAGR of 25% by 2034, playing a central role in the voluntary carbon credit market. This sector focuses on sustainable land management and ecosystem restoration while simultaneously promoting biodiversity preservation. Reforestation projects have proven to be highly impactful, not only for their carbon sequestration potential but also for their social and economic contributions to local communities. These integrated strategies are reshaping the landscape of climate change mitigation, ensuring that carbon reduction is coupled with positive outcomes for both the environment and society.

The U.S. voluntary carbon credit market is expected to generate USD 2 billion by 2034. This growth is driven by increased corporate net-zero commitments and a rising consumer demand for sustainable practices. Companies are utilizing high-quality carbon credits to achieve emissions reduction targets while bolstering their environmental, social, and governance (ESG) performance. In the U.S., nature-based solutions, particularly in reforestation and clean energy projects, are gaining significant traction. Additionally, the integration of blockchain technology is revolutionizing the carbon credit market by enhancing transparency, traceability, and trust in carbon credit transactions, making it a more efficient and reliable market for buyers and sellers alike.
